Comparison of pressure-swing distillation and heterogeneous azeotropic distillation for recovering benzene and isopropanol from wastewater
Two methods of pressure-swing distillation (PSD) and heterogeneous azeotropic distillation (HAD) are investigated to recover benzene and isopropanol from wastewater. This ternary mixture can form two homogenous azeotropes (binary) and two heterogeneous azeotropes (binary and ternary), which all are sensitive to pressure. The proposed configurations are rigorously simulated and optimized based on the minimum total annual cost (TAC) via the sequential iterative procedure, and meanwhile the partial heat integration is taken into account respectively. The results show that both configurations of PSD are superior to the HAD configuration combining with PSD from the perspectives of economic and energy. (C) 2018 Institution of Chemical Engineers.
